Herc had a fantastic conversation with Daryl Dike, striker for West Bromwich Albion in the EFL Championship and the first guest of Vamos in 2024. There are few things as great as opening up the mind of an athlete. Daryl shared all about his recent Achilles injury, and how it affects athletes both mentally and physically. He also talked about his experiences living in England, his plans for the upcoming year, and much more. Plus, Herc analyzed Christian Pulisic as the best-ever American player with a club career, but not yet close to being the best-ever for USMNT.
